MAST CELLS MEDIATE THE SEVERITY OF EXPERIMENTAL CYSTITIS IN MICE

This study indicates that mast cells modulate the inflammatory response of the bladder to SP and LPS in mice. Although clinical trials of the use of antihistamines to treat or prevent cystitis have not been successful, these results suggest that therapies directed toward preventing mast cell activation may yet prove effective in treating cystitis.
